1980s: Generalisation of fidelity cards and product bar-codes,<br />

introduction in France of smart cards for payments purposes.<br />

1992: Amex embarks on an alliance strategy for the 'frequent<br />

traveller' market, making membership miles convertible into<br />

'Connect Plus' and vice versa, starting the trend of broadening the<br />

purpose of private currencies.<br />

1994: The first Positive ID chips surgically implanted in the necks of<br />

dogs are successfully marketed in Silicon Valley.<br />

1995: Total outstanding 'narrow purpose' corporate scrip tops $30<br />

billion in value for the first time; 30 million rechargeable smart cards<br />

for payments in circulation in France: 88 million smart cards issued in<br />

Germany for national health record management; in Finland the<br />

central bank issues a combined payment, social security and health<br />

management smart card.<br />

1996: Joint venture between Microsoft and Barclays to design<br />

electronic money systems. Merger of CNN and Time-Wamer creating<br />

the largest 'content' empire. Introduction of Internet stations in public<br />

places in the UK. Implementation of the new World Trade<br />

Organisation (WTO) Treaty, dismantling most remaining national<br />

barriers to international trade. Sensar, a pioneering biometric<br />

company, signs contracts with NCR and OKI Electric industry for iris<br />

scanning devices in Automatic Teller Machines (ATMs).<br />

1997: The first Britons get internet access via home TV sets.<br />

Biometric iris scanners operational in Japan and London. A pilot<br />

project between US and Bermudan Immigration authorities uses<br />

automatic hand-reading devices to expedite the processing of<br />

frequent travellers. Mircrosoft introduces Virtual Wallet in its<br />
